Background
The fume exhauster is also called as fume exhauster, and is a kitchen electric appliance for purifying kitchen environment. The smoke exhaust ventilator is arranged above a kitchen range of a healthy energy-saving kitchen range hood, can rapidly exhaust waste burnt by the kitchen range and oil smoke harmful to human bodies generated in the cooking process, and exhaust the waste and the oil smoke to the outside, reduces pollution, purifies air, and has the safety guarantee effects of gas defense and explosion prevention.
Related with current house design, there is the potential safety hazard in the installation use of current lampblack absorber. At present, in many high-rise apartments, families of multiple households share the same flue, exhaust pipes of range hoods are connected to the same flue, when fire occurs in the flue, the fire easily enters the room along the pipeline of the range hoods through the flue, and fire disasters are caused, so that the high-rise apartment is extremely unsafe.
To this defect, install the fire prevention check valve on the flue usually, current fire prevention check valve, its defect that exists is: only the middle position of the fireproof check valve is provided with a fusing mechanism, when the flame avoids the middle position, the flame still easily enters the flue, and the fire is not tight enough.

Detailed Description
A multi-fuse type fireproof check valve comprises a check valve air door seat 1, wherein an oil smoke exhaust hole is formed in the middle of the check valve air door seat 1, an air door plate 3 used for shielding the oil smoke exhaust hole is installed on the check valve air door seat 1 on one side of the oil smoke exhaust hole through a rotating shaft hinge component 2, supporting plates 4 are welded on the check valve air door seats 1 on two adjacent sides of the rotating shaft hinge component 2, one ends of the supporting plates 4 on two sides, which are close to the rotating shaft hinge component 2, are welded with supporting rods 5, sliding grooves 4-1 are formed in the supporting plates 4 on two sides in an inclined mode from one end of the supporting rods 5 to the other end, pressing rods 6 used for extruding and shielding the air door plates 3 on the oil smoke exhaust hole are connected in the sliding grooves 4-1 in a sliding mode, two ends of the pressing rods 6 are connected to two ends of tension springs 7, one end, which is, a pull rod 8 penetrates through the middle position of the support rod 5, a first fusing hook 9-1 and a second fusing hook 9-2 are respectively fixed at two ends of the pull rod 8, the first fusing hook 9-1 is hooked on the pressure rod 6, a connecting rod 10 arranged in parallel with the pressure rod 6 is hooked on the second fusing hook 9-2, a third fusing hook 9-3 and a fourth fusing hook 9-4 which are respectively hooked at two ends of the connecting rod 10 are fixed on the check valve air door seat 1, and the melting points of the first fusing hook 9-1, the second fusing hook 9-2, the third fusing hook 9-3 and the fourth fusing hook 9-4 are not more than 150 ℃.
Wherein the third fusing hook 9-3 and the fourth fusing hook 9-4 are respectively positioned at the position of one fourth of the edge of the air valve seat 1 of the check valve. The structure is designed so that the middle position of the air door seat 1 of the check valve is provided with a fusing mechanism (a first fusing hook 9-1 and a second fusing hook 9-2), and the middle fusing mechanism is still provided with a fusing mechanism (a third fusing hook 9-3 and a fourth fusing hook 9-4) from the middle fusing mechanism to the middle of the two side edges.
The pull rod 8 is sleeved with a spring 11, one end of the spring 11 is pressed against the support rod 5, and the other end of the spring 11 is pressed against the first fusing hook 9-1.
The application is an improvement on the basis of the prior art, and the improvement is as follows: a third fusing hook 9-3 and a fourth fusing hook 9-4 are added. The first fusing hook 9-1, the second fusing hook 9-2, the third fusing hook 9-3 and the fourth fusing hook 9-4 are arranged to form a fusing surface, when a fire occurs, the first fusing hook 9-1, the second fusing hook 9-2, the third fusing hook 9-3 and the fourth fusing hook 9-4 can be timely fused when the temperature exceeds 150 ℃, any one of the fusing hooks can be fused to enable the pressure lever 6 to be out of limit, and the pressure lever 6 can be extruded on the wind door panel 3 under the action of the tension spring 7 to play a role in fire prevention. The safety of fire prevention is improved.
